About Sander van Herwaarden
Sander van Herwaarden is a scholar working on Physical and Theoretical Chemistry, Organic Chemistry and Atmospheric Science, having authored 5 papers that have together received 475 indexed citations. Recurring topics across this work include thermodynamics and calorimetric analyses (3 papers), Advanced MEMS and NEMS Technologies (2 papers) and Chemical Thermodynamics and Molecular Structure (2 papers). The work is most often cited by research in Polymers and Plastics (263 citations), Biomaterials (186 citations) and Physical and Theoretical Chemistry (61 citations). Sander van Herwaarden has collaborated with scholars based in Netherlands and Poland. Frequent co-authors include Vincent Mathot, Thijs Pijpers, M. Pyda and Geert Vanden Poel. Their work appears in journals such as Thermochimica Acta and Procedia Engineering.
